Abstract

The utility model discloses a connector with adjustable adapting wire diameter for a connector, which comprises a connecting sleeve, a fastening sleeve and a rubber sleeve, the connecting sleeve is of a hollow structure, one end of the connecting sleeve is provided with an annular pressing part, the back end of the annular pressing part is provided with an external thread, the annular pressing part comprises a plurality of fastening teeth which are arranged at equal intervals, the fastening teeth are comb-tooth shaped, the rubber sleeve is arranged at the inner side of the annular pressing part, an internal thread matched with the external thread is arranged in the fastening sleeve, the aperture of the fastening sleeve is gradually reduced from one end close to the connecting sleeve to one end far away from the connecting sleeve, the lower end of the rubber sleeve is provided with a groove, a baffle ring matched with the rubber sleeve is arranged in the connecting sleeve, and a protruding block matched with the groove is arranged on the baffle ring. Through changing the gum cover one, just can make the connector be applicable to different connecting wires.

Description

Adapter wire diameter adjustable connector for connector
Technical Field
The utility model belongs to the technical field of the connector, in particular to adapter line footpath adjustable connector for connector.
Background
The connector on the existing connector is only suitable for the connecting wire with one diameter, and the connecting wires with different diameters need to purchase connectors with various specifications.
SUMMERY OF THE UTILITY MODEL
The utility model aims at providing a connector with adjustable adapter wire diameter to solve the problem of proposing among the above-mentioned background art.
In order to achieve the above object, the utility model provides a following technical scheme:
a connector with an adjustable adapting wire diameter for a connector comprises a connecting sleeve, a fastening sleeve and a rubber sleeve, wherein the connecting sleeve is of a hollow structure, an annular pressing part is arranged at one end of the connecting sleeve, external threads are arranged at the rear end of the annular pressing part, the annular pressing part comprises a plurality of fastening teeth which are arranged at equal intervals, the fastening teeth are in a comb tooth shape, the rubber sleeve is arranged on the inner side of the annular pressing part, internal threads matched with the external threads are arranged in the fastening sleeve, and the aperture of the fastening sleeve is gradually reduced from one end close to the connecting sleeve to one end far away from the connecting sleeve; the lower end of the rubber sleeve is provided with a groove, a baffle ring matched with the rubber sleeve is arranged in the connecting sleeve, and a protruding block matched with the groove is arranged on the baffle ring.
The groove is an annular groove.
The protruding blocks are connected to form an annular snap ring.
The baffle ring and the snap ring are arranged on the inner wall of the connecting sleeve and are positioned at one end of the outer thread close to the annular pressing part.
The rubber sleeve comprises a first rubber sleeve and a second rubber sleeve, the first rubber sleeve comprises an inner sleeve of a hollow cylinder structure and a limiting ring arranged on the inner sleeve, the second rubber sleeve is arranged on the inner sleeve, and the annular groove is arranged between the first rubber sleeve and the second rubber sleeve and is positioned at one end far away from the limiting ring.
The utility model has the advantages of being relatively to prior art, when using this connector, put into the connector with the rubber sleeve, make annular groove card on the snap ring, the rubber sleeve lower extreme is fixed, it is spacing that the rubber sleeve upper end is compressed tightly the portion by cyclic annular, then revolve the fastening sleeve on the external screw thread of cyclic annular portion rear end that compresses tightly, the interval between the fastening tooth that the cyclic annular portion compresses tightly reduces, with this realization to compressing tightly of rubber sleeve, meanwhile, the rubber sleeve fastens the connection to the connecting wire, the producer has the same outer aperture and has the gum cover of different hole diameters through making one, through changing gum cover one, just can make the connector be applicable to different connecting wires.
